O que é um Browser?
Um browser, também conhecido como navegador, é um software utilizado para acessar e visualizar páginas da web. Ele permite que os usuários naveguem na internet, visualizem conteúdos multimídia, interajam com sites e realizem diversas atividades online. Os browsers são essenciais para a experiência de navegação na web e desempenham um papel fundamental na forma como interagimos com a internet.
Funcionalidades de um Browser
Os browsers possuem uma ampla gama de funcionalidades que tornam a navegação na web mais fácil e eficiente. Alguns dos recursos mais comuns incluem:
1. Renderização de Páginas
Os browsers são responsáveis por interpretar o código HTML, CSS e JavaScript de uma página da web e exibi-la corretamente para o usuário. Eles utilizam um mecanismo de renderização para processar esses elementos e apresentar o conteúdo de forma visualmente agradável.
2. Gerenciamento de Abas
Os browsers permitem que os usuários abram várias abas simultaneamente, o que facilita a organização e o acesso a diferentes sites. Isso permite que os usuários alternem entre as abas de forma rápida e fácil, mantendo várias páginas abertas ao mesmo tempo.
3. Histórico de Navegação
Os browsers registram o histórico de navegação dos usuários, armazenando informações sobre os sites visitados. Isso permite que os usuários acessem facilmente páginas visitadas anteriormente, simplificando a navegação e facilitando a recuperação de informações.
4. Favoritos e Marcadores
Os browsers permitem que os usuários salvem sites favoritos ou marcadores para acessá-los rapidamente no futuro. Essa funcionalidade é útil para armazenar e organizar sites frequentemente visitados, facilitando o acesso a eles sem a necessidade de digitar o endereço completo.
5. Pesquisa Integrada
A maioria dos browsers possui uma barra de pesquisa integrada, que permite que os usuários realizem pesquisas na web diretamente da interface do navegador. Isso elimina a necessidade de abrir um mecanismo de busca separado e agiliza o processo de pesquisa.
6. Gerenciador de Downloads
Os browsers possuem um gerenciador de downloads que permite que os usuários baixem arquivos da internet. Essa funcionalidade permite que os usuários controlem e monitorem o progresso dos downloads, além de facilitar o acesso aos arquivos baixados posteriormente.
7. Bloqueador de Pop-ups
Os browsers geralmente possuem um bloqueador de pop-ups integrado, que impede que janelas indesejadas sejam abertas automaticamente durante a navegação. Isso melhora a experiência do usuário, evitando interrupções e protegendo contra anúncios invasivos.
8. Autocompletar
Os browsers possuem uma funcionalidade de autocompletar, que sugere automaticamente palavras ou frases enquanto o usuário digita em campos de formulário. Isso agiliza o preenchimento de formulários e evita erros de digitação.
9. Gerenciador de Senhas
Alguns browsers possuem um gerenciador de senhas integrado, que permite que os usuários armazenem e gerenciem suas senhas de forma segura. Isso facilita o preenchimento automático de senhas em sites e aumenta a segurança, evitando o uso de senhas fracas ou repetidas.
10. Modo de Navegação Privada
Os browsers oferecem um modo de navegação privada, também conhecido como modo anônimo, que permite que os usuários naveguem na web sem que suas informações de navegação sejam registradas. Isso é útil para manter a privacidade e evitar o armazenamento de cookies, histórico e outras informações pessoais.
11. Suporte a Extensões
Alguns browsers permitem que os usuários instalem extensões, que são pequenos programas que adicionam funcionalidades extras ao navegador. Essas extensões podem variar desde bloqueadores de anúncios até ferramentas de produtividade, personalizando a experiência de navegação de acordo com as preferências do usuário.
12. Sincronização de Dados
Alguns browsers oferecem a opção de sincronizar dados entre dispositivos, permitindo que os usuários acessem seus favoritos, histórico e outras informações em diferentes computadores ou dispositivos móveis. Isso facilita a continuidade da navegação e evita a perda de dados importantes.
13. Suporte a Padrões Web
Os browsers são desenvolvidos para suportar os padrões web, como HTML, CSS e JavaScript, garantindo que os sites sejam exibidos corretamente e funcionem adequadamente. Isso permite que os desenvolvedores criem sites compatíveis com diferentes browsers, garantindo uma experiência consistente para os usuários.
